Acquire Technological Competencies



Mastering technical skills is fundamental for just a restoration artist, as it ensures precision and care when managing fragile and valuable artworks. Start by becoming proficient with numerous tools and materials generally used in restoration, such as scalpels, brushes, adhesives, and specialized cleaning brokers. Being familiar with how distinctive products interact is very important to stay away from producing unintended problems.

A stable grasp of chemical rules is important. Learn about solvents, varnishes, and binding media, as well as how to safely handle and utilize them. Recognizing the chemical composition of pigments, metals, textiles, together with other resources aids you make informed conclusions for the duration of restoration, making certain compatibility and lengthy-time period security.

Furthermore, embrace modern systems to boost your restoration capabilities. Electronic imaging approaches, including infrared reflectography, ultraviolet fluorescence, and X-ray Evaluation, assist you to take a look at artworks beneath the surface area levels. Microscopy is an additional essential Resource for analyzing great information, identifying material degradation, and documenting restoration development with precision.

Creating retouching and inpainting competencies is equally vital. This includes matching colors, textures, and brushstrokes to seamlessly integrate repairs with the first artwork. Tactics like glazing and layering require endurance along with a meticulous method of achieve genuine final results.

Also, knowing structural conservation solutions is essential, specially when managing fragile artifacts, sculptures, or architectural features. Discover approaches for stabilizing canvases, repairing tears, and consolidating weakened resources.

Continual observe and experimentation are important to refining complex skills. Engage in workshops, masterclasses, and Sophisticated education courses to stay up-to-date on new applications, supplies, and tactics. Have an understanding of Moral Guidelines



Comprehending ethical recommendations is actually a cornerstone of accountable artwork restoration. Restoration artists will have to solution each project with a strong sense of integrity, making sure their work preserves the first artist's intent and the artwork's historic benefit. Moral techniques With this subject are guided by rules for example small intervention, reversibility, and whole documentation.

Small intervention signifies generating the minimum quantity of modifications necessary to stabilize and preserve the artwork. This tactic can help keep the initial supplies and authenticity of the piece. Around-restoration may result in the loss of historical aspects, altering the artist's original eyesight, And that's why restraint is vital.

Reversibility is another vital basic principle. Restoration treatment options ought to be done in a method that permits future conservators to reverse or modify them without the need of detrimental the original artwork. This is crucial due to the fact restoration components and techniques evolve after some time, and long run breakthroughs may offer you much better methods.

Comprehensive documentation is important for keeping transparency in the restoration course of action. Comprehensive documents from the artwork's ailment, the components made use of, as well as the techniques utilized should be held just before, all through, and right after restoration. This makes certain that long term conservators have a transparent idea of the perform performed.

Expert businesses like the American Institute for Conservation (AIC) supply moral guidelines that set sector standards. These contain respecting cultural heritage, prioritizing the artwork's very long-term preservation, and engaging in ongoing Studying to remain up-to-date with best methods.
